H5777 Hebrew עוֹפֶרֶת ʻôwphereth
9 occurrences 9 in Old Testament

Exodus

15:10

Thou didst blow with thy wind, the sea covered them: they sank as lead in the mighty waters.

Numbers

31:22

Only the gold, and the silver, the brass, the iron, the tin, and the lead,

Job

19:24

That they were graven with an iron pen and lead in the rock for ever!

Jeremiah

6:29

The bellows are burned, the lead is consumed of the fire; the founder melteth in vain: for the wicked are not plucked away.

Ezekiel

22:18

Son of man, the house of Israel is to me become dross: all they are brass, and tin, and iron, and lead, in the midst of the furnace; they are even the dross of silver.

22:20

As they gather silver, and brass, and iron, and lead, and tin, into the midst of the furnace, to blow the fire upon it, to melt it; so will I gather you in mine anger and in my fury, and I will leave you there, and melt you.

27:12

Tarshish was thy merchant by reason of the multitude of all kind of riches; with silver, iron, tin, and lead, they traded in thy fairs.

Zechariah

5:7

And, behold, there was lifted up a talent of lead: and this is a woman that sitteth in the midst of the ephah.

5:8

And he said, This is wickedness. And he cast it into the midst of the ephah; and he cast the weight of lead upon the mouth thereof.
